Lately my tailgate has been dropping straight down as if it didn't have the slow lowering and lift assist. Upon inspecting, I noticed the little rubber bushing in the corner is torn and crushed. Should be something covered under bumper to bumper correct? If not has anyone had to replace it and know the cost?

There are two parts that might be causing the issue. There is the bushing(#2 in diagram), which is GM 25815554 list $6.05, and there is a hinge damper (#5 in diagram) GM 23115812 list $94.28. The damper is located inside the taillight pocket, behind the hinge. The taillight needs to be removed to gain access to it.

 

I would say that all parts should be covered by the 3/36 warranty.
